How do you put images in middle of an article?

It tells you on the right of editing the article how to format the images.
(img1 center, large)
~but used the other brackets.
where it says center, you can write either center, left or right.

As you type your article, wherever you want the image to appear, i.e. under a certain sentence, you just type on a line underneath img1 center, large. But remember to have those in the square brackets, these kind ][ not )(
